My Students
My students range from ELD (English is a second language) to High Achieving (GATE). My school is in a very diverse part of Los Angeles where students come from a variety of cultural and ethnic backgrounds.
My students love to learn and want to been seen as the leaders among the other students at our school.
They love to use math tools, create their own stories and share their learning with others. My goal is to get them reading, writing and actively learning every day. I have only been in the classroom with my students for a week now and they love reading core literature. I am trying to teach them to challenge themselves and accept others for who they are. I want to be able to bring in a diverse range of novels to study this year and push my students to believe in not only themselves but our future.
My Project
In my classroom, I have a lot of students and sometimes the students like to sit in other places besides their desks. They like to sit on the floor, on a yoga ball or even on a rolling chair, this would give them the opportunity to sit in a comfortable space that allows them to move freely around the room but gives them the ability to remain seated. The other element of flexible seating is having something to write on, so having access to a clipboard for every student would make this element possible.
Students love to move and remain active daily giving them the opportunity to have flexible seating will activate their brains and allow them to access a different way of learning.
